metalite: ADaM Metadata Structure
Description
A metadata structure for clinical data analysis and reporting based on Analysis Data Model (ADaM) datasets. The package simplifies clinical analysis and reporting tool development by defining standardized inputs, outputs, and workflow. The package can be used to create analysis and reporting planning grid, mock table, and validated analysis and reporting results based on consistent inputs.

Construct ADaM mappings
Description
ADaM mappings describe how variables and meta information in the ADaM data are mapped to standardized term.
Usage
adam_mapping(
name,
id = NULL,
group = NULL,
var = NULL,
subset = NULL,
label = NULL,
...
)
Arguments
name |
A character value of term name. The term name is used as key to link information. |
id |
A character value of subject identifier variable name in an ADaM dataset. |
group |
A character vector of group variable names in an ADaM dataset. |
var |
A character vector of useful variable names in an ADaM dataset. |
subset |
An expression to identify analysis records.
See |
label |
A character value of analysis label. |
... |
Additional variables. |
Details
The design is inspired by ggplot2::aes()
.
Value
A list with class adam_mapping
.
Components of the list are either quosures or constants.
Examples
adam_mapping(
name = "apat",
id = "USUBJID",
group = "TRT01A",
subset = TRTFL == "Y",
label = "All Participants as Treated"
)

A function to assign labels to a data frame
Description
A function to assign labels to a data frame
Usage
assign_label(data, var = names(data), label = names(data))
Arguments
data |
A data frame. |
var |
The variables to assign labels. |
label |
The labels to be assigned. |
Details
Case 1: If the variable's label is already define in the original data frame but not redefined in
assign_label(...)
, its original labels will be kept.Case 2: If the variable's label is already define in the original data frame but re-defined by
assign_label(...)
, its labels will be re-defined.Case 3: If the variable's label is not define in the original data frame but it is defined by
assign_label(...)
, its labels will added.Case 4: If the variable's label is not define in the original data frame, neither was it defined by
assign_label(...)
, its labels will be the variable name itself.
Value
A data frame with labels updated.
Examples
assign_label(r2rtf::r2rtf_adae) |> head()
assign_label(
r2rtf::r2rtf_adae,
var = "USUBJID",
label = "Unique subject identifier"
) |> head()

Construct outdata
class
Description
The outdata
class defines a standard output format for
analysis and reporting.
Usage
outdata(
meta,
population,
observation,
parameter,
n,
order,
group,
reference_group,
...
)
Arguments
meta |
A metadata object created by metalite. |
population |
A character value of population term name. The term name is used as key to link information. |
observation |
A character value of observation term name. The term name is used as key to link information. |
parameter |
A character value of parameter term name. The term name is used as key to link information. |
n |
A data frame for number of subjects in each criteria. |
order |
A numeric vector of row display order. |
group |
A character vector of group variable names in an ADaM dataset. |
reference_group |
A numeric value to indicate reference group in levels of group. |
... |
Additional variables to save to |
Details
The design is inspired by ggplot2::aes()
.
Value
A list with class outdata
.
Components of the list are either quosures or constants.
Examples
outdata(
meta = meta_example(),
population = "apat",
observation = "wk12",
parameter = "rel",
n = data.frame(
TRTA = c("Placebo", "Xanomeline Low Dose", "Xanomeline High Dose"),
n = c(86, 84, 84)
),
group = "TRTA",
reference_group = 1,
order = 1:3
)
Create a analysis plan from all combination of variables
Description
This function is a wrapper of base::expand.grid()
.
Usage
plan(analysis, population, observation, parameter, mock = 1, ...)
Arguments
analysis |
A character value of analysis term name. The term name is used as key to link information. |
population |
A character value of population term name. The term name is used as key to link information. |
observation |
A character value of observation term name. The term name is used as key to link information. |
parameter |
A character value of parameter term name. The term name is used as key to link information. |
mock |
A numeric value of mock table number. |
... |
Additional arguments. |
Value
A data frame containing the analysis plan.
Examples
# Example 1
# Create an analysis plan of AE summary
# with any AE, drug-related AE, and serious AE
plan(
analysis = "ae_summary",
population = "apat",
observation = c("wk12", "wk24"),
parameter = "any;rel;ser"
)
# Example 2
# Create an analysis plan of AE specific
# with any AE, drug-related AE, and serious AE
plan(
analysis = "ae_specific",
population = "apat",
observation = c("wk12", "wk24"),
parameter = c("any", "rel", "ser")
)
